I was "In Production" for weeks after my build date was confirmed and window sticker was provided. When I called they told me it will stay like this if there is even a small little item they had to wait on - for example - the tow hitch, or PPF or the smallest of things where it does not pass QA - it will remain in that state. What they cannot tell you - is exactly what it is - that is holding it up. Then like magic - mine got released and shipped - within a 2 day period. I will never know (nor does my dealer) why. Super frustrating - but hang in there - it will come.

Few things.
1. BBB is just an old school Yelp or Google review before the explosion of the internet. The name makes people think its government related but its a private business that can't do anything other than post reviews...that the owner can pay to be taken down.
2. This whole thing has been a hot mess. The sooner you accept that time doesn't exist in the Ford world, the happier you will be.
3. What is probably happening is that your Bronco is built but if you have any extras like towing or Paint Protection, it is sent to a separate facility. If they have run out of any little thing, it will keep your Bronco from being shipped.
4. Dont hold your breath after its shipped. There are rail delays and apparently a truck driver shortage. Further delaying delivery.
5. There are some lucky people who got their Bronco fast but most have been stuck in one of the stages for a long time. I have had my Vin and build date since June. It just got built 2 weeks ago.

I know its frustrating but hang in there. Most of us have just accepted it but if you look at threads from a few months ago, you will feel the tears through your computer screen.
